Transaction 2d21a80794af4bbdabd4e147aed58ce145b031e55e8fa48b9ed213f88aeaffaf

1 Input
2 Outputs
  • 2d21a80794af4bbdabd4e147aed58ce145b031e55e8fa48b9ed213f88aeaffaf:0
  • value  17667116
    address  169UKeStLNw5cuw6VvwwwochpRqopGJQcG
  • 2d21a80794af4bbdabd4e147aed58ce145b031e55e8fa48b9ed213f88aeaffaf:1
  • value  231048815
    address  1AA6QNj5xoAarNaPnDegACLf6LvvkFg8Uk